Kythira Island vs Little Rock, Arkansas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Kythira Island, Greece and Little Rock, Arkansas, Usa is approximately 9,660 km or 6,003 mi.
  • To reach Kythira Island in this distance one would set out from Little Rock, Arkansas bearing 46.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Kythira Island bearing 131.9° or SE .
  • Kythira Island has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Little Rock, Arkansas has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• The average annual temperature is 1.1 °C (2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9 °C (16.2°F) less in Kythira Island.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 750 mm (29.5 in) less which is equivalent to 750 l/m² (18.41 US gal/ft²) or 7,500,000 l/ha (801,800 US gal/ac) less. About 3/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.6° lower in Kythira Island than in Little Rock, Arkansas.
  • Relative humidity levels are 9.6%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.3°C (5.9°F) higher.
